Overview
- The Colorado Rockies snapped Chicago’s sweep bid with a 6-4 victory in the series finale at Coors Field, moving to 21-69 while the White Sox fell to 30-60.
- Mickey Moniak went 3-for-4 with a leadoff home run and two-run triple, finishing just a double shy of a cycle and collecting his 13th homer of the season.
- Michael Toglia delivered the go-ahead two-run homer in the fifth inning, breaking a 4-4 tie and fueling a four-run frame for Colorado.
- Rookie right-handers Shane Smith and Chase Dollander each made early career starts, with Smith allowing five earned runs in 4 1/3 innings and Dollander yielding three runs over 3 2/3 innings.
- Chicago failed to achieve its first series sweep of the season and Colorado extended its home-series skid to a record-tying 17 consecutive losses.
